Population

Metric Chico California Avg U.S. Average
Population 81,119 38,909,900 334,821,731
Population density (per sq mi) 2349.8 237.3 85.8
Population growth (%/yr) 0.86% 0.19% 0.57%
Median age 32.9 35.4 37.1
Households 35,644 13,415,389 128,459,983

Population in Chico grew by 21.0% from 2009 to 2023, reaching 85,978 in 2023.

Economy

Chico has a the economy index of D, which means it is barely prosperous.

Metric Chico California Avg U.S. Average
Median household income $66,108 $96,718 $78,145
Income growth (%/yr) 6.39% 6.01% 5.07%
Unemployment rate 6.6% 6.4% 5.2%

The median household income in Chico is about 32% lower than in California.

Housing

Metric Chico California Avg U.S. Average
Median home price $740,498 $642,203 $242,182
Median rent $1,421 $1,955 $1,342
Homeownership rate 45.0% 55.8% 65.1%

The median home price in Chico is about 43.4 years' worth of rent — buying at the median price costs roughly as much as paying the median rent of $1,421 per month for that long.

Commute Time & Mobility

Commuters in Chico spend about 26 minutes on the road round trip each working day. Over a typical 250-day work year, that adds up to roughly 109 hours, about 4.5 full days, spent commuting.

Metric Chico California Avg U.S. Average
One-way commute (min) 13.0 23.6 22.5
Round-trip commute (min) 26.1 47.2 44.9
Yearly time spent (hours) 109 197 187
Estimated yearly cost $3,366 $6,099 $5,803
Work from home 12.5% 15.5% 13.4%
Highway traffic (vehicles/day) 12,697 16,509 8,813
Local road traffic (vehicles/day) 3,322 2,449 1,355

The average commute time in Chico is 13 minutes, shorter than the 24 minutes in California.

Estimated yearly cost applies a single national wage rule of thumb (U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ics average hourly earnings), not a measurement of wages in this area. Traffic volume figures come from proprietary Ticon and TrafficZoom data.
